As an expert in teaching families to start online businesses, I am
asked a lot of questions about selling on the Internet. By far the
most common question is, "What do I sell on the Internet?"
The answer is...you are asking the wrong question. Why? Because
products come and go, but the people you are marketing to remain
forever. Meaning, the product you are selling this year may not be
the same product you are selling next year, but you will be selling
to the same people. That is, if you are collecting their name and
email on your web site.
That is why your top priority as an online business owner (after you
determine what your niche is) is to collect the emails of your
visitors. This can be done with a simple email capture form
available with any autoresponder service. Then you can use that
autoresponder service to send sequential messages to the people on
your email list.
For example, if Bob joins your email list (via your email capture
form at the top of your home page) on Monday, he will begin
receiving an email every 7 days about who you are, what your
credentials are, what you are selling, why they should buy from you
as opposed to the other guy, and so on. If Sally joins a month
later, she will start receiving your messages in the order she needs
to receive them.
Sally will not receive the same message 17 that Bob is receiving
because she needs to receive messages 1 through 16 first! The
messages that Bob is receiving since he joined a month before will
not make sense to her. That is why you need to send sequential
emails through an autoresponder.
Think about that! How many of your products require more than one
email to answer all the objections your customers have? Or how many
of your products require some basic knowledge before your customers
realize they can't live without it? Nothing is better than
sequential emails for getting the job done.
Another benefit of sequential emails is that people will see them
eventually even if they join your email list at month later. This
catches the missed sales that are so prevalent when online business
owners have a single promotion that misses everyone who came to the
web site after the promotion is over.
So, get an email capture form and place it front and center on your
home page or most popular page. Offer something really valuable in
exchange for their first name and email. It doesn't have to be
expensive, a downloadable report, mini-course via email or a link to
a video will do, but it should be something that your customer
really wants to entice him to give you his most prized
possession...his email address!
Concentrate on building that list of email subscribers and you will
have an online business for years to come. Neglect building an email
list and you are at the mercy of products that may not last past
year's end!
